3rd man arrested in Sharon theft



SHARON, Pa. -- Police have arrested a third man in the theft of $22,000 from a disabled 50-year-old Sterling Avenue man.
Brian J. Harris, 20, of Second Avenue, was arrested at his home Wednesday on charges of criminal conspiracy, receiving stolen property and theft by deception.
He was arraigned before District Justice James McMahon on Thursday and held in Mercer County Jail on $10,000 bond.
Police said he and Edward Chacon, 29, of South Jackson Street, Youngstown, and Samuel J. Beers, 18, of Diamond Street, Masury, are charged with stealing the money between September and October 2003.
The scheme involved one of the group pretending to be an investment attorney who spoke with the victim on the telephone and persuaded him to write checks for investments and legal services, police said.
The checks were cashed and the money spent by the three suspects, police said.
Chacon and Beers were arrested in October and pleaded guilty in the case, police said, adding that they only recently learned Harris' identity.
